The 2005 Pan American Women's Handball Championship was the eighth edition of the Pan American Women's Handball Championship, held in Brazil. It acted as the American qualifying tournament for the 2005 World Women's Handball Championship.

Standings[edit]

Team Pld W D L GF GA GD Pts
 Brazil (H) 5 5 0 0 166 56 +110 10
 Argentina 5 4 0 1 122 103 +19 8
 Uruguay 5 3 0 2 118 139 −21 6
 Canada 5 2 0 3 106 139 −33 4
 Dominican Republic 5 1 0 4 115 143 −28 2
 United States 5 0 0 5 91 138 −47 0
